10. Litchfield (NT)
Positioned in Australia’s top end, 100 kilometres south-west of Darwin, Litchfield National Park is spectacular all year round and boasts the best of the Australian outback.
Explore Florence Falls, Tabletop Swamp, Greenant Creek, Wangi Falls and Walker Creek, soaking up the unique wonder of this truly incredible place.

Biscayne National Park, Florida: This park off the coast of southeast Florida is 95 percent underwater, comprising 30 small islands in addition to 173,000 acres of beautiful blue waters filled with colorful sea life, coral reefs, and dozens of shipwrecks. To put it simply, Biscayne National Park is a paradise for scuba divers and snorkelers. If you’re not experienced with either of these activities, it’s a great place to learn.

Kaziranga National Park
Kaziranga National Park, is an esteemed national park of India. This protected area of Assam has no dearth of distinct flora and fauna. Due to which, in the year 1985 it has designated as one of the famous natural World Heritage Site of our country.
This national park was established in the year 1905 as a Reserve forest. Since than it has achieved a notable success in wildlife conservation. All thanks to the first efforts made by the Mary Victoria Leiter Curzon, wife of Viceroy of India Lord Curzon in the British era.
